It's never too late. You can get your ADN (Associate's Degree in Nursing, just be sure they have the RN option) in around two years at a technical college. After that, you can go on to a university and get into the ADN to BSN program if you'd like a bachelor's. That is exactly what I did, and now I'm working on my Master's. I'm 27. Good luck!

Many Community Colleges have nursing programs, and it's usually a two year degree, but, some of them have incredible waiting lists, but if your grades or entrance exams are high enough, you can move up the list fairly quickly. If not...you can at least get your general requirements done while you wait for a spot, remembering that each A would move you up. However best to check with your intended choice school on what exactly is the procedure. It's never too late to start or restart school. I wish you the best of luck.
